Patient Chief Concern
Protrusion

What learning would you share with other Invisalign providers?
By intentionally applying overcorrection to create an anterior open bite, it is possible to maintain control over the torque for the protruded anterior teeth while stabilizing posterior occlusal settling. With the appropriate use of TADs and elastics, sufficient retraction can be achieved with Invisalign treatment, effectively addressing protrusion.

What contributed most to this treatment being successful?
The success factors of this case can be divided into two main aspects. First, in the primary order, overcorrection was used intentionally so the patient would have an anterior open bite at the final stage. This overcorrection allowed for better control of torque on the anterior teeth while stabilizing the posterior occlusal settling, leading to a more controlled treatment outcome. Second, skeletal anchorages (TADs) were inserted near the maxillary and mandibular first molars (total 4 TADs were placed). By using elastics between the precision hook and TADs, the protrusion was effectively resolved.

Clinical Indications

  • Crowding
  • Increased overjet
  • Mandibular midline deviation
  • Narrow arches
  • Rotations
The patient had protrusion of the anterior teeth, a large overjet, and a V-shaped arch.

Modalities

  • Distalization
  • Extraction
  • Mesialization
  • Retraction
  • TADs
The 2nd premolar-2nd molar were designed to move mesially, and anterior teeth were designed to be retracted distally to close the extraction space of 1st premolars (maxillary and mandibular, total four 1st premolars were extracted). Four TADs were placed near the four 1st molars and elastics were used between the precision hook and the TADs to retract the anterior teeth.

Summary

Severely protruded incisors were retracted successfully through 1st premolar extraction and distal retraction (with TADs). Achieved proper torque of anterior teeth, Class I relationship, functional canine guidance on both sides, normal overjet and overbite, significant improvement of overjet. midline coincidence. proper axial inclination of incisors, curve of Spee leveled, arches aligned and coordinated, alignment of both arches through de-rotation, arch form improved, aesthetic smile line, and harmonic arches.
